About Mahesh Jampani
Mahesh Jampani is a scholar working on Geochemistry and Petrology, Environmental Engineering and Industrial and Manufacturing Engineering, having authored 25 papers that have together received 602 indexed citations. Recurring topics across this work include Groundwater and Watershed Analysis (9 papers), Groundwater and Isotope Geochemistry (8 papers), Geophysical and Geoelectrical Methods (6 papers), Wastewater Treatment and Reuse (5 papers), Groundwater flow and contamination studies (5 papers), Water resources management and optimization (3 papers), Water Quality and Pollution Assessment (3 papers) and Urban Agriculture and Sustainability (2 papers). The work is most often cited by research in Geochemistry and Petrology (243 citations), Environmental Engineering (265 citations) and Water Science and Technology (194 citations). Mahesh Jampani has collaborated with scholars based in India, Sri Lanka and Germany. Frequent co-authors include V. V. S. Gurunadha Rao, L. Surinaidu, G. Tamma Rao, Priyanie Amerasinghe, Sahebrao Sonkamble, Rudolf Liedl, Ratnakar Dhakate, Stephan Hülsmann, R. Rajesh and Shakeel Ahmed. Their work appears in journ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Water Research.
